Rep. Michael A. Rulli Unloads Shares of The Allstate Corporation (NYSE:ALL)

Representative Michael A. Rulli (Republican-Ohio) recently sold shares of The Allstate Corporation (NYSE:ALL). In a filing disclosed on September 02nd, the Representative disclosed that they had sold between $1,001 and $15,000 in Allstate stock on August 12th. The trade occurred in the Representative’s “MERRILL LYNCH SIMPLE MANAGED ACCOUNT” account.

Allstate (NYSE:ALLG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Wednesday, August 5th. The insurance provider reported $8.99 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$6.06 by $2.93. Allstate had a return on equity of 41.64% and a net margin of 18.97%.The firm had revenue of $18.60 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$15.46 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ned $5.94 earnings per share. Allstate’s revenue for the quarter was up 11.8% on a year-over-year basis. Equities analysts anticipate that The Allstate Corporation will post 34.78 EPS for the current year.

Allstate Announces Dividend

The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Thursday, October 1st. Investors of record on Monday, August 31st will be given a $1.08 dividend. This represents a $4.32 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 1.6%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Monday, August 31st. Allstate’s dividend payout ratio is presently 8.63%.

About Representative Rulli

Michael Rulli (Republican Party) is a member of the U.S. House, representing Ohio’s 6th Congressional District. He assumed office on June 25, 2024. His current term ends on January 3, 2027.

Rulli (Republican Party) is running for re-election to the U.S. House to represent Ohio’s 6th Congressional District. He declared candidacy for the 2026 election.

Michael Rulli graduated from Poland Seminary High School. He earned a degree from Emerson College. Rulli’s career experience includes working as the director of operations with Rulli Bros. Markets.

Allstate Corporation is a publicly traded insurance company headquartered in Northbrook, Illinois, and is one of the largest personal lines property and casualty insurers in the United States. Founded in 1931 as a subsidiary of Sears, Roebuck and Co, Allstate has grown into a diversified insurer that serves millions of consumers and businesses through a mix of distribution channels and product offerings.

The company underwrites a broad range of insurance products, with primary emphasis on auto and homeowners coverage.
